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28932 9966912 31 443915027 460185972
787901 22
787901 22
38 16 490712
All about undefined
Interested in learning more?
787901 22
38 16 490712
See more
2803511703 6078
1150 15509784 71037 737
See more
48098 24756
60255 4602796 64069418
See more